Newcode raises total funding to €17m as Irish headcount doubles
Global agentic AI platform Newcode has raised fresh funding that brings its total investment to €17m ($20m), as the company targets further international expansion and continues to grow its Irish operation. The company, whose Irish business is led by Cork native and former Mason Hayes & Curran LLP solicitor Donna O’Leary, has doubled its Irish headcount to 60 since establishing operations here in March.
